2007 Barolo Gavarini Vigna Chiniera, Elio Grasso, Piedmont
If you are a fan of Burgundy and want to buy a wine from the Elio Grasso stable then this is the one for you. Made from the fruit of 35 year old vines planted on a mixture of limestone, sand and chalk, it is highly charged with aromas of almond blossom and white pepper. The palate has notes of black cherry and tar, with plenty of ripe, fat tannin, balanced by lace-like acidity. Very complex, with great intensity, this is my favourite wine from this estate.
